Texas Roadhouse Seasoned Rice

Ingredients
  

2 cups long-grain white rice

4 cups chicken broth (or vegetable broth for a vegetarian option)

1 tablespoon olive oil

1 small onion, finely chopped

2 cloves garlic, minced

1 teaspoon onion powder

1 teaspoon garlic powder

1 teaspoon smoked paprika

1 teaspoon dried parsley

1 teaspoon cumin

1 teaspoon salt (adjust to taste)

1/2 teaspoon black pepper

1/2 cup frozen corn (optional)

1/2 cup diced bell pepper (red or green)

Fresh parsley for garnish

Instructions
 

In a medium saucepan, heat the olive oil over medium heat. Add the chopped onion and sauté for about 3-4 minutes until the onion is translucent.

    Stir in the minced garlic and sauté for an additional minute until fragrant.

      Add the long-grain rice to the onion and garlic mixture, stirring to coat the rice with the oil. Toast the rice for about 2 minutes, stirring frequently.

        Pour in the chicken broth and bring to a boil.

          Once boiling, add the onion powder, garlic powder, smoked paprika, dried parsley, cumin, salt, and black pepper. Stir well to combine.

            If using, add the corn and diced bell pepper at this point.

              Reduce the heat to low, cover, and simmer for 18-20 minutes or until the rice is cooked and liquid is absorbed. Avoid lifting the lid during cooking to keep steam trapped.

                Once cooked, remove from heat and let it sit, covered, for an additional 5 minutes.

                  Fluff the rice with a fork before serving, adjusting seasoning if necessary.

                    Garnish with fresh parsley and serve warm alongside your favorite Texas-style dishes.

                      Prep Time: 10 min | Total Time: 40 min | Servings: 4-6
